Explanation:
a) Iron has the tendency to undergo rusting -- this is a chemical property as it involves a reaction with water and air.
b) Precipitation in industrialized areas often has an acidic nature -- this is also a chemical property due to its interaction with bases or metals.
c) Hemoglobin is red in color -- this is a physical property since it doesn't entail any chemical reactions.
d) When water is left out in sunlight, it evaporates gradually -- this is a physical property because the process can easily be reversed, classifying it as a physical change.
e) During photosynthesis, plants convert carbon dioxide into more complex molecules -- this demonstrates a chemical property since it involves chemical reactions.
To determine the quantity of moles of gas in the sample of chlorine gas, we utilize the ideal gas equation
which is PV=nRT
n=number of moles
R= gas constant (62.36367 l.torr/k.mol)
P=pressure
V=volume
From the ideal gas equation, we can derive n= PV/RT
n= (328 x5.0)/ (62.36367 x310)= 0.085 moles
